What are the advantages of copper shower faucets over alloys?
The advantages of copper shower faucets over alloys are mainly reflected in corrosion resistance, antibacterial properties and long-term use costs.
1. Corrosion resistance
Copper shower faucets have excellent corrosion resistance and can effectively resist oxides and corrosive substances in water, thereby extending their service life. In contrast, alloy faucets may be more susceptible to corrosion in humid environments, resulting in a shorter service life.
2. Antibacterial properties
Copper has natural antibacterial properties, which can kill bacteria and microorganisms in water and ensure the cleanliness and hygiene of water. All-copper shower faucets are particularly good in this regard, while alloy faucets may be slightly inferior in antibacterial properties.
3. Long-term use costs
Although the price of all-copper shower faucets is higher, their corrosion resistance and antibacterial properties make maintenance costs lower and more economical in the long run. Although alloy faucets are cheaper, the long-term use costs may be higher due to more frequent maintenance and replacement.
